Im folgenden Kapitel werden die Ursprünge der Embodied-Cognition-Perspektive dargestellt und … Cognition is embodied when it is deeply dependent upon features of the physical body of an agent, that is, when aspects of the agent's body beyond the brain play a significant causal or physically constitutive role in cognitive processing. Embodied, extended, enactive, embedded or 4e cognition is an emerging view in cognitive science and philosophy of mind challenging the traditional representationalist, "brainbound" view that mind is internal to the human brain. phenomenology in social cognition debates.
